LGMH= Lime Green Mickey Heads. From the Disney paint collection at Home Depot. Actual color is alien green. People use them to proclaim their allegiance to the DIS. Like how, I've heard, some cruises get the same wrist band for all the DISers on the ship. To help spot each other.
